| Term | geographic tongue | ID (Ontology) | DOID:1455 (Human Disease) |
| Definition | An atrophic glossitis that is characterized as an inflammatory condition of the mucous membrane of the tongue, usually on the dorsal surface. | ||
| Also Known As | "benign migratory glossitis" ; "Glossitis areata exfoliativa" ; "Pityriasis linguae" | ||
